Description

Hunters are delighted to offer to the market a four bedroom detached house located in the sought-after village location of Blyton which has a number of amenities including local shop public houses ice cream parlour school and more with a regular bus route between Scunthorpe and the Cathedral city of Lincoln. The property is within the catchment area of the well regarding Queen Elizabeth high school and has UPVC double glazing and oil fired central heating.
Accommodation comprising of entrance hallway lounge dining room kitchen diner utility room downstairs shower room and to the first floor are four bedrooms and the family bathroom. Viewing highly recommended.

Accommodation - Composite double glazed Entrance door with side window leading into:

Entrance Hallway - Stairs rising to first floor, radiator, laminate flooring. Doors giving access to:

Dining Room - 4.48m x 3.23m - uPVC double glazed window to the front elevation with radiator below, laminate flooring, dado rail.

Lounge - 4.48m x 4.39m - uPVC double glazed bay window to the front elevation with radiator below, brick built fireplace with stone hearth and multi fuel burner.

Kitchen Diner - 6.42m x 3.30m - Two uPVC double glazed windows and French doors to the rear elevation looking out to the garden and fields beyond, fitted kitchen comprising base, drawer and wall units with complementary work surfaces and tiled splash backs, inset sink and drainer with mixer tap, integrated double oven, four ring electric hob and extractor over, integrated dishwasher, space for fridge freezer, inset spotlights to the ceiling. Doorway leading to:

Utility Room - 3.25m x 2.18m with recess - Provision for automatic washing machine and space for dryer. Composite Entrance door with double glazed side window leading out to the garden with field views beyond, fitted base, wall and larder units with complementary work surfaces, inset stainless steel sink and drainer, tiled splash backs, radiator.

Downstairs Shower Room - 2.41m x 0.89m - Three piece suite comprising w.c., pedestal wash hand basin, shower cubicle , tiling to the walls, heated towel rail.

First Floor Landing - uPVC double glazed window to the front elevation, radiator. Doors giving access to:

Master Bedroom - 4.49m x 4.40m - uPVC double glazed window to the front elevation with radiator below, range of fitted furniture including wardrobes, overhead storage, bedside drawer units and matching dressing table.

Bedroom - 3.61m x 3.30m - uPVC double glazed window to the rear elevation overlooking the garden and fields beyond, radiator, uPVC double glazed door to the side elevation, access to loft space.

Bedroom - 3.94m x 3.23m - uPVC double glazed window to the rear elevation with field views and radiator.

Bedroom - 3.78m x 3.20m - uPVC double glazed window to the front elevation with radiator below.

Bathroom - 2.64m x 2.24m - uPVC double glazed window to the rear elevation, four piece suite comprising w.c., hand basin in base unit, corner bath and separate shower with tiling to the walls and inset spots. Chrome spiral heated towel rail and door giving access to linen cupboard.

Externally - To the front there is a block paved L-shaped driveway allowing off-road parking for multiple vehicles with a raised gravel low maintenance area to the front and attached single double length garage. Externally to the rear is an enclosed garden mainly set to lawn with field views.

Potential Buyer Information - Estate agents operating in the UK are required to conduct Anti-Money Laundering (AML) checks in compliance with the regulations set forth by HM Revenue and Customs (HMRC) for all property transactions. It is mandatory for both buyers and sellers to successfully complete these checks before any property transaction can proceed. Our estate agency uses Coadjute’s Assured Compliance service to facilitate the AML checks. A fee will be charged for each individual AML check conducted
